At temperatures around some appropriate reference temperature
T
ref
, a chemical reactions rate constant
k(T)
, represented by the Arrhenius equation, can also be described by a simpler exponential model. This Demonstration converts the Arrhenius equation activation energy
E
a
(in kilojoules/mole or kilocalories/mole) into the exponential model
c
parameter (in
-1
°C
) for a chosen
T
ref
. Similarly, it converts the exponential model
c
parameter into a corresponding activation energy as defined by the Arrhenius equation. The conversions permit using published
E
a
values in software for predicting degradation and synthesis patterns written for the exponential model, or comparing calculated
c
values with known activation energies.
